| Obverse description | Name of country and year of issue along the upper edge, denomination in the lower middle, German Eagle in the middle of the coin, surrounded by the 12 stars of the European Union. Mintmark right of the eagle. |
|---|---|
| Obverse script | Latin |
| Obverse lettering | BUNDESREPUBLIK DEUTSCHLAND 2025 25 EURO D |
| Reverse description | The Three Holy Kings (Heilige Drei Könige) depicted in the middle of the coin. The Christ Child is in the manger in the center, two dromedaries in the background. Star of Bethlehem with its tail floats above the depiction. Mintmark on the lower right of the picture. The motif is being surrounded by the text `Heilige Drei Könige` along the edge. |
